# PayFast Subscription Integration (Node.js/Express)

This package provides a modular Express router to integrate with [PayFast](https://www.payfast.co.za/) for managing subscription payments, including:

- Submitting subscription payment forms to PayFast
- Handling ITN (Instant Transaction Notification) webhooks
- Cancelling active subscriptions via PayFast's API
- Callback hooks for custom payment and cancellation handling

## βœ… Features

- πŸ” Signature generation for secure PayFast communication
- πŸ”„ Subscription initiation and recurring billing setup
- πŸ“¬ ITN webhook handling with signature + source validation
- ❌ Cancel PayFast subscriptions with retry logic
- πŸ”„ Fetch PayFast subscriptions
- πŸ”„ Pause PayFast subscriptions
- πŸ”„ UnPause PayFast subscriptions
- πŸ“¦ Clean, pluggable Express router with optional callbacks

## πŸ“‹ Requirements

- Node.js 14+
- Express 4+

## πŸ“¦ Installation

Install from npm:

```bash
npm install @ngelekanyo/payfast-subscribe
```

## βš™οΈ Environment Setup

Create a `.env` file in your root directory:

```env
PAYFAST_MERCHANT_ID=your_merchant_id
PAYFAST_MERCHANT_KEY=your_merchant_key
PAYFAST_PASSPHRASE=your_passphrase
PAYFAST_API_VERSION=v1
PAYFAST_RETURN_URL=https://yourdomain.com/payment-success
PAYFAST_CANCEL_URL=https://yourdomain.com/payment-cancel
PAYFAST_NOTIFY_URL=https://yourdomain.com/api/payfast/notify
TESTING_MODE=true
```

## πŸš€ Usage

In your Express server:

```js
const express = require("express");
const cors = require("cors");
const buildPayfastRouter = require("@ngelekanyo/payfast-subscribe");

const app = express();

const handlePaymentUpdate = async (itnData) => {
console.log("πŸ’° Payment received:", itnData);
// e.g., update database, activate subscription
};

const handleCancel = async ({ token, subscriptionId, status, payload }) => {
console.log("❌ Cancel callback called:", {
token,
subscriptionId,
status,
payload,
});
// e.g., mark subscription as cancelled in your system
};

const handlePause = async ({ token, status, payload }) => {
console.log("⏸️ Pause callback called:", {
token,
status,
payload,
});
// e.g., mark subscription as paused in your system
};

const handleUnpause = async ({ token, status, payload }) => {
console.log("▢️ Unpause callback called:", {
token,
status,
payload,
});
// e.g., resume subscription in your system
};

const handleFetch = async ({ token, status, payload }) => {
console.log("πŸ“„ Fetch callback called:", {
token,
status,
payload,
});
// e.g., update subscription status from fetch data
};

app.use(cors());
app.use(express.json());
app.use(express.urlencoded({ extended: true }));

app.use(
"/api/payfast",
buildPayfastRouter(
handlePaymentUpdate,
handleCancel,
handlePause,
handleUnpause,
handleFetch
)
);

app.listen(6000, () => console.log("Server running on http://localhost:6000"));
```

## πŸ”Œ Exposed Routes

| Method | Route | Description |
| ------ | -------------------------------------------- | --------------------------------------------- |
| POST | `/api/payfast/initiate` | Generate PayFast payment data + URL |
| POST | `/api/payfast/notify` | Handle ITN (Instant Transaction Notification) |
| POST | `/api/payfast/cancel/:token/:subscriptionId` | Cancel an active PayFast subscription |
| POST | `/api/payfast/cancel/:token` | Cancel an active PayFast subscription |
| POST | `/api/payfast/pause/:token` | Pause an active subscription |
| POST | `/api/payfast/unpause/:token` | Unpause a paused subscription |
| GET | `/api/payfast/fetch/:token` | Fetch subscription details |

## πŸ“Œ Subscription ID Explanation

The `subscriptionId` parameter in the `cancelSubscription` method refers to a unique identifier for a subscription record in **your application’s database** (e.g., a `subscriptions` table).

This ID is typically generated by your backend when a subscription is created, and is stored **alongside the PayFast `payfast_token`**.

### 🧠 Context

If you use a service like **Supabase** to manage subscriptions, `subscriptionId` could simply be the `id` column of your `subscriptions` table β€” uniquely identifying each user’s subscription.

### βœ… Usage

When calling `PayFastService.cancelSubscription`, pass:

- the **`payfast_token`** (provided by PayFast), and
- your **local `subscriptionId`**
to ensure the correct subscription is cancelled **both** on PayFast and in your own system.

## πŸ›‘οΈ Security

- Validates PayFast's signature on every ITN
- Verifies source IP matches PayFast domains
- Uses CSRF/session token for authenticated cancellation
- Retry logic for expired CSRF/session (e.g., HTTP 419)

## ⚠️ Pause/Unpause Disclaimer

> **Important Notice:**
> The `pause` and `unpause` subscription features provided by this package rely on PayFast's native subscription behavior. Please review the following carefully before implementing:

- Pausing a subscription **does not cancel it** β€” it only delays future billing by the number of paused cycles (e.g. `cycles: 1` = 1 billing interval).
- The **subscription end date is automatically extended** by PayFast for each paused cycle.
- **Unpausing early** (before the pause period ends) will **not adjust the next billing date** β€” billing still resumes after the full pause duration.
- ⚠️ This may result in a user receiving more than a full billing cycle of access without being charged, unless you **enforce access control** on your side.
- This package does **not automatically manage user access** during pause periods. You must implement that logic in your backend or authorization layer.
